Though often described in dreamlike terms, the concept rests on relatable human perceptions: sound, subtle movement, and psychological attribution. In intimate or quiet settings, faint noises—creaks, warmth, faint whispers—combined with dim lighting and the mind’s tendency to project familiar presence, create the compelling impression that a space holds more than it appears. This effect isn’t supernatural but rooted in sensory experience and cognitive processing. Patterns of fleeting activity—an unresponsive corner, a lingering chill, or an impossible timing—become anecdotal evidence of mystery. While the “roommate” is not literal, the room feels alive because perception shapes reality, especially when loneliness or stress heightens sensitivity to the unknown.

Q: Could it be a psychological phenomenon?
Yes. Stress, isolation, and habituated attention to routine can amplify minor stimuli into vivid, unexplained impressions—common in shared rooms under low stimulation.
Q: What causes the ‘presence’ of movement others sense?
Airflow, floorboard settling, temperature diffusion, and motion-detection equipment quirks often register as mysterious activity in still environments.
